Is it harassment if we compliment a woman. If we say she has a pretty smile, or if she mentions she just got her hair done and we say it looks nice.

Again, every situation is different. If you compliment a woman, there is NOTHING wrong with that. Just remember that it's not what you say or how you say it, it's how the person takes it.

That actually happens a lot. Those situations don't rise to the level of harassment/sexual harassment, but they can. If you compliment someone and they say thank you and keep it moving, then there is typically no problem. It's the times when someone thinks you mean it differently that a woman can make a complaint. Something so petty like this, at least where I work, would be a slap on the wrist. You'd come into my office, I'd remind you that you should keep your comments and opinions to yourself since it could possibly make someone else uncomfortable.

Remember that someone else's perception is their reality. It is very common that people take things differently than how you mean it. That's why when I ask questions during interviews, I always ask, "did you do something that COULD HAVE violated department policy?" That question is different than, "did you do something that could have possibly made (insert woman's name here) uncomfortable?"

If you're complimenting someone over and over after you've been told that the behavior is not acceptable, THAT rises to the level or harassment/sexual harassment. A compliment one time, assuming its safe for work, is almost always a non-issue.

Is it harassment if we compliment a woman. If we say she has a pretty smile, or if she mentions she just got her hair done and we say it looks nice.

It's not really about what is or isn't harassment - it's about what can be considered harassment. Context is everything. If you're at a meeting full of coworkers and tell a woman her new haircut looks nice, you probably don't have anything to fear. If you're in an elevator with just you and that woman and say the exact same thing, the words aren't as important anymore - the details surrounding the words are. She could say she felt intimidated because you waited until you were both isolated and felt "pressured" into responding to the compliment positively.


I dont know how to put it because it's something that is definitely situational. Every case is different. If a connection can be made between a policy violation and the workplace, it's fair game. i.e. Guy offers to carpool with girl. they carpool for 10 months. (long time on purpose) One day, she complains to boss that she hates carpooling with guy, but can't tell him she doesn't want to carpool anymore because guy is best friends with manager and she fears she wont get a good review coming up. Girl gets subpar review, she complains that she's felt "forced" to carpool for fear of him talking with manager about girl.... and now we have an investigation.

something so simple like doing someone a favor can be turned into some kind of harassment/sexual harassment allegation.

But the guy she's carpooling with has not anything wrong in this situation. It's not like the guy is blackmailing her

That doesn't matter. Simply because the guy has a friendship with the manager, the other employee in this scenario can state that she thought responding negatively would put her job in jeopardy. An employee with a close relationship with their manager can use it as a means of influence over other employees who don't. This is why many managers have fraternization guidelines for interactions with their employees.
